Two Days Till Boxing Writers Dinner in NYC!
Only days away from the Academy Awards of boxing, the BWAA has just announced that Mike Alvarado, fresh off his spectacular win over Brandon Rios, will be attending.
He joins an ever growing list of boxing celebrates which includes Nonito Donaire, Juan Manuel Marquez, Roy Jones Jr., Timothy Bradley, Ruslan Provodnikov, Paul Malignaggi, Steve Cunningham, Gennady Golovkin, Danny Jacobs, Bob Arum, and Jim Lampley.
There will be ample opportunities to take photos, get autographs, and chat with the many celebrities in attendance.
Dave Diamante the host of NBC's sports show “The Lights” will serve as Master of Ceremonies. All ticket holders will receive a gift bag valued at approximately $125.
